Here's how you can do it: Access the wp-config.php file via an FTP client or your hosting provider's file manager. Locate the following line in the file: define('WP_DEBUG', false); and change it to define('WP_DEBUG', true);. Add the following lines of code below the line you just modified: define('WP_DEBUG_LOG', true);

WP_DEBUG is a PHP constant (a permanent global variable) that can be used to trigger the "debug" mode throughout WordPress. It is assumed to be false by default, and is usually set to true in the wp-config.php file on development copies of WordPress. // This enables debugging. define( 'WP_DEBUG', true ); // This disables debugging.

With those settings, WordPress will now log errors, warnings, and notices to a debug.log file located in /wp-content/debug.log Log files in production environments are security threats so IF you decide to have logging on a production environment, it would be a good idea to set your .htaccess file to deny access to the log file (or similarly use ...
